Total Information Patriot Act Searches To Continue

Filed under Democrats, Election 2008, Homeland Insecurity, Legislation, Liberty by jclifford at 7:07 am

Congratulations, Mr. Bush. The Total Information Awareness project you have so craftily hidden away in the National Security Agency can now legally continue, thanks to the renewal of the Patriot Act.

As Senator Russ Feingold has pointed out, the new version of the Patriot Act only puts a fig leaf over the law’s grave violations of Americans’ constitutional rights. It’s the Patriot Act that has enabled the Bush White House to gather Americans’ private information into the huge government databases that form the basis for the continued work on the Total Information Awareness program.

President Bush has proven, time and again, that he has no respect for the liberty guaranteed to all people in the USA by the Bill of Rights. Whether it’s the Total Information Awareness program, military programs to spy on Americans, or the NSA warrantless wiretapping program, Bush has proved that he cannot be trusted with any extraordinary powers. Nonetheless, yesterday, the Senate handed extraordinary powers to George W. Bush, all wrapped up with glitter and a bow.

It’s bad enough that every single Republican in the Senate voted for the renewal without pushing for meaningful reform of the bill. What’s worse? 14 Democratic senators voted for the bill as well, still too afraid to stand up to George W. Bush, even when he has the worst interests of the American people at heart. If Paul Revere came riding by their homes, these Democratic senators would call the police about the violation of a sound ordinance, and then roll over and go back to sleep.

These Democrats ought to be ashamed of themselves:

  • Joseph Biden, Delaware
  • Senator Tom Carper of Delaware
  • Senator Hillary Clinton of New York
  • Senator Kent Conrad of North Dakota
  • Senator Diane Feinstein of California
  • Senator Tim Johnson of South Dakota
  • Senator Herb Kohl of Wisconsin
  • Senator Mary Landrieu of Louisiana
  • Senator Blanche Lincoln of Arkansas
  • Senator Bill Nelson of Florida
  • Senator Ben Nelson of Nebraska
  • Senator Mark Pryor of Arkansas
  • Senator John Rockefeller of West Virginia
  • Senator Charles Schumer of New York

    Joseph Biden and Hillary Clinton have both made it clear that they want to run for President in 2008. They’re counting on you not to remember this vote. Will you cooperate?
